Children's Literature

This book is part of a series Entitled "Insects and spiders' that includes books about beetles, moths and butterflies, bugs, flies, and dragonflies. Beginning with what a spider is, this book discusses its habitats, life cycle, predators, and defenses. The meanings of words written in bold print can be found in the glossary. A table of contents, an index, and a quiz at the end of the book help make the book a useful tool for student research. The photographs are plentiful, with lots of details and interesting variations. "Fascinating Facts" and "Did you know?" information is written on green and yellow leaves throughout the book. One of the fascinating facts was that there are about 2,000 kinds of spiders in Australia! Readers will be interested in the sections on "Weird and wonderful spiders" and another section that explains how to find spiders to watch. This book is a good resource not only for research purposes, but also for those who just want to enjoy a closer look at the spider's world. 2002 (orig. 2001), Chelsea House Publishers, Ages 8 to 12.
β€”Vicki Foote
